Things To Do
in Kent
Kent, located in Washington State, is a vibrant city known for its rich history and diverse community. Nestled between Seattle and Tacoma, it serves as a hub for outdoor enthusiasts with ample parks and recreational opportunities. Kent is also home to a variety of cultural attractions, including museums and theaters, making it an ideal destination for tourists.
With its friendly atmosphere and beautiful landscapes, Kent provides a delightful experience for visitors of all ages.
Day Trips
Spend a day exploring around
Start your day with breakfast at a local café followed by a visit to the Kent Historical Museum to learn about the city's past.
Enjoy lunch at a food truck nearby, then stroll through the beautiful Kent Station, where you can shop and explore local boutiques.
Wrap up your day with dinner at a well-rated restaurant, followed by catching a live performance at the Kent Performing Arts Center.
Begin with a hike at the scenic Soos Creek Trail that offers stunning views of nature and wildlife.
Pack a picnic and head to Lake Meridian Park for a relaxing afternoon by the water, where you can also rent paddle boats.
Return to the city for dinner at a popular gastropub, followed by a visit to a local bar to enjoy some live music.
Prices
Item | Price |
---|---|
🍔Meal at a restaurant | $15-$30 |
☕Coffee | $3-$5 |
🚌Public transportation fare | $2.50 |
🏨Hotel room (per night) | $100-$200 |
🛍️Groceries (weekly) | $70-$150 |

Tipping in Kent
Ensure a smooth experience
It is customary to tip around 15-20% at restaurants, and some may add a service charge for larger groups.
Credit and debit cards are widely accepted, but it's advisable to carry some cash for smaller vendors and markets.
